See the License for the specific language governing permissions and * limitations under the License. * */ #ifndef QCLOUD_IOT_UTILS_HTTPC_H_ #define QCLOUD_IOT_UTILS_HTTPC_H_ #ifdef __cplusplus extern "C" { #endif #include #include "network_interface.h" #define HTTP_PORT 80 #define HTTPS_PORT 443 typedef enum { HTTP_GET, HTTP_POST, HTTP_PUT, HTTP_DELETE, HTTP_HEAD } HttpMethod; typedef struct { unsigned char profile_idx; int remote_port; int response_code; char * header; char * auth_user; char * auth_password; qcloud_Network network_stack; } HTTPClient; typedef struct { bool is_more; // if more data to check bool is_chunked; // if response in chunked data int retrieve_len; // length of retrieve int response_content_len; // length of resposne content int post_buf_len; // post data length int response_buf_len; // length of response data buffer char *post_content_type; // type of post content char *post_buf; // post data buffer char *response_buf; // response data buffer } HTTPClientData; /** * @brief do one http request * * @param client http client * @param url server url * @param port server port * @param ca_crt_dir ca path * @param method type of request * @param client_data http data * @return QCLOUD_RET_SUCCESS for success, or err code for failure */ int qcloud_http_client_common(HTTPClient *client, const char *url, int port, const char *ca_crt, HttpMethod method, HTTPClientData *client_data); int qcloud_http_recv_data(HTTPClient *client, uint32_t timeout_ms, HTTPClientData *client_data); int qcloud_http_client_connect(HTTPClient *client, const char *url, int port, const char *ca_crt); void qcloud_http_client_close(HTTPClient *client); #ifdef __cplusplus } #endif #endif /* QCLOUD_IOT_UTILS_HTTPC_H_ */
